Halloween Scavenger Hunt (with free printable)

This free printable Halloween scavenger hunt is perfect for kids of all ages!

This time of year when the holidays begin is a exciting time for kids. Of course, they love dressing up and trick-or-treating but with a fun Halloween Scavenger Hunt, the fun can last a couple extra days longer.

Just give the kids this (free) printable Halloween Scavenger Hunt while you walk around your neighborhood or a decorated area, and have them check off all the themed items they find.

It’s a simple, fun and great activity for a Kid’s Halloween Party, to take with you on a family walk, or even trunk or treat!

I thought it’d be fun to create this fun Halloween scavenger hunt you an either play with your kids before Halloween, at a school or friends Halloween party, birthday party or even a few days before the holiday when neighbors or a part of town has a lot of themed decorations.

Add this printable Halloween Scavenger Hunt to your list of favorite Halloween games, and you’ll have a fun, safe and most Happy Halloween!

Halloween Scavenger Hunt Ideas 

Here are some ideas how to use this printable Halloween Scavenger hunt.

 

Halloween Party Activity

A spooktacularly fun activity to add a little friendly competition to your Halloween party whether it’s in a classroom, at your home, a birthday party or neighborhood get-together. Simply print out the 2-page Halloween scavenger hunt, and send them on their way!

Birthday Party Around Halloween

If your child has a birthday around Halloween and you’re hosting a party, this is a fun party game if you’re in a decorated place and can set the kids free to find all 32 items on these two printable scavenger hunts.

To add a little fun to the festivities, have a few themed prizes or glow in the dark necklaces they can use while trick-or-treating.
